A woman from Gateshead has been left with a raft of life-long health problems caused by medication taken during her mother's pregnancy. Women should be on a pregnancy prevention programme when taking Sodium Valproate, according to guidelines. Janet Williams and Emma Murphy founded INFACT, a group founded in 2012 by two mums who have children affected by exposure to Sodium Valproate. ITV News Tyne Tees contacted the drugs companies who manufacture products using Sodium Valproate. Aspire Pharma say their generic product which uses Sodium Valproate was approved for sale in the UK by 2020.
